Hi I just got a 1986 Rx7 that was sitting in a barn for 13 years. I have done a lot so far to get it down the road. I'm trying to fix the minor things now and one of the biggest problems I have is no heat. When I try to use it the fan kicks on and I can hear the flaps open and shut for the different vents but still no heat. If you have any ideas feel free to comment.

It could be a clogged heater core as mentioned, or the mixer motor (not sure if that's its specific name, it's been a while) might not be functioning and instead stuck on the vents/AC setting. You should be able to hear it move when you move between the Cold/Hot settings with the car off.
